A Test of Resolve

President Trump has slammed Russian President Vladimir Putin, accusing him of “playing with fire” following heavy bombardments on Ukrainian cities targeting civilians. These comments came as Russia launched its largest attack on Ukraine in three years, raising international alarm. Trump’s critics and supporters alike now question whether he will translate these words into decisive actions, namely tougher sanctions against Russia, or will this be another instance of his bluster without follow-through?

The Specter of Escalation

The unpredictability of the situation is further complicated by Dmitri Medvedev, deputy chairman of the Kremlin’s security council, who cautioned that increased tensions could lead to all-out war, potentially spiraling into a global conflict. The U.S.’s response has remained inconsistent, providing mixed signals on its involvement in this escalating conflict. While Congress appears to be in favor of enacting sanctions, with Senator Lindsey Graham working with the White House, there’s little indication of Trump’s readiness to back such measures unequivocally. Waiting for a Definitive Move

Adding fuel to the fire, White House Press Secretary Karoline Leavitt suggested that the responsibility for the conflict could be placed at the feet of President Biden, while emphasizing Trump’s aspirations for a peaceful negotiated settlement. This political back and forth offers little reassurance or resolution, particularly for those seeking to uphold Ukraine’s territorial integrity.
